Q: Name the stages of non-cooperation movement?

What is the difference between noncooperation movement and civil Disobedience movement?

The noncooperation movement aimed to boycott British goods and institutions, while the civil disobedience movement involved breaking specific laws as a form of protest, both were led by Mahatma Gandhi in India's struggle for independence. Noncooperation was more about passive resistance and noncompliance, whereas civil disobedience was more active and involved breaking unjust laws.
